Frequently Asked Questions
What is a Parks and Recreation Master Plan?
It’s a guiding document that the Municipality will use to organize and prioritize plans for parks, recreational programs, and facilities, in the short, medium, and long-term. Strategies will inform park and recreation development and upkeep, connectivity opportunities, improvements, and more!
Considerations will include, but are not limited to:
- Current and anticipated use
- Community needs and desires
- Opportunities to improve leisure service delivery and programming
- Operational and fiscal realities
- Continued maintenance and funding
- Short-, mid-, and long-term planning horizons
